Understanding Mental Health Assessment
Mental health assessments are methodical examinations performed to figure out a person's psychological, psychological, and social well-being. These assessments are important for recognizing mental health concerns and shaping subsequent intervention strategies.
Goal of Mental Health AssessmentsDiagnosis: Identify mental health disorders or conditions.Standard Measurement: Establish a beginning point for monitoring development.Treatment Planning: Tailor interventions to specific needs.Danger Assessment: Evaluate the capacity for self-harm or damage to others.Types of Mental Health Assessments
There are a number of types of mental health assessments, each designed to capture unique aspects of psychological well-being:
Assessment TypeDescriptionClinical InterviewsStructured or disorganized conversations to gather comprehensive information.Self-Report QuestionnairesSurveys that allow people to self-disclose their sensations and behaviors.Behavioral AssessmentsObservations and reports on an individual's habits in different settings.Psychological TestingStandardized tests to determine specific cognitive, emotional, and behavioral aspects.
The choice of assessment approach frequently depends upon the context and specific requirements.
Implementing Assessments
Mental health assessments can take place in multiple contexts, including:
Healthcare Settings: Conducted by psychologists, psychiatrists, or other healthcare suppliers.Educational Institutions: Utilized to recognize students who may require additional support.Offices: Implemented to improve staff member wellness and productivity.The Role of Technology
With the arrival of telehealth and online platforms, assessments have actually ended up being more available. Digital tools can facilitate remote examinations, offering higher flexibility for both professionals and people seeking support.
Support Systems for Mental Health
As soon as mental health requirements are determined through assessment, it's essential to supply adequate support. There are numerous avenues to offer support, both official and informal.
Types of Mental Health SupportPsychotherapy/Counseling: Essential for addressing mental health concerns, offering coping strategies and insights.Support Groups: Peer-led groups that supply shared experiences and mutual encouragement.Medication Management: Pharmaceuticals recommended to handle symptoms of mental health disorders.Crisis Intervention Services: Immediate support for people in distress.Importance of a Supportive Environment
Developing an environment conducive to mental wellness is vital. A helpful atmosphere can enhance healing and promote well-being. Key elements consist of:
Open Communication: Encouraging conversations on mental health without fear of preconception.Education and Awareness: Providing info on mental health issues minimizes misconceptions.Ease of access: Ensuring resources are easily available to those in need.Methods for Providing Support
Organizations and neighborhoods can carry out several methods to cultivate support:
Mental Health Training: Equip staff and community members with the skills to acknowledge and react to mental health concerns.Employee Assistance Programs (EAPs): Offering counseling services and resources to employees and their families.Policy Development: Establishing policies that promote mental wellness in work environments and academic settings.FAQs About Mental Health Assessment and Support1. What does a mental health assessment include?
A mental health assessment typically consists of interviews, questionnaires, and in some cases psychological screening to evaluate an individual's emotional and psychological state.
2. The length of time does a mental health assessment take?
The period of an assessment varies depending upon the approach used, but it usually lasts between 30 minutes to a couple of hours.
3. Is mental health support private?
Yes, mental health support services should adhere to confidentiality laws, making sure that individual details stays private.
4. Can I self-refer for mental health assessment?
Yes, individuals can seek assessments separately through healthcare providers or mental health companies.
5. What should I expect during a therapy session?
Throughout therapy, individuals can anticipate a safe area to go over sensations, thoughts, and habits while dealing with an experienced professional to develop coping techniques and insights.
